Provenance
The papers of Benjamin S. Loeb, economist, author, and government official, were given to the Library of Congress by Loeb in 2000.
Transfers
Audio cassette recordings have been transferred to the Library's Motion Picture, Broadcasting, and Recorded Sound Division where they are identified as part of these papers.
Related Material
The Loeb Papers complement the Glenn Theodore Seaborg Papers also located in the Manuscript Division of the Library of Congress. The General Correspondence and Writings series in the Seaborg Papers contain large quantities of correspondence between Seaborg and Loeb concerning their collaborative efforts.
